npm 切换依赖包下载源地址
一、直接切换
1、查看当前npm配置的依赖下载地址
npm config get registry
2、更改下载地址为公司内部npm仓库地址(私服)
(Nexus私服搭建学习:https://juejin.cn/post/7013963693633306661)
npm config set registry http://156.11.1.117:8899/repository/XXX-npm-group/
3、想切换回npm仓库或者淘宝镜像仓库
切回npm官方仓库
npm config set registry https://registry.npmjs.org/
切回淘宝镜像地址
npm config set registry https://registry.npm.taobao.org
二、通过nrm进行管理下载源
全局安装npm源管理工具-nrm
npm i nrm -g
查看是否安装成功
nrm --version
列出可选的下载源,如下
nrm ls
*npm ---------- https://registry.npmjs.org/
yarn --------- https://registry.yarnpkg.com/
tencent ------ https://mirrors.cloud.tencent.com/npm/
cnpm --------- https://r.cnpmjs.org/
taobao ------- https://registry.npmmirror.com/
npmMirror ---- https://skimdb.npmjs.com/registry/
配置私服下载地址
nrm add 【名称】 【地址】
nrm add private http://156.11.1.117:8899/repository/XXX-npm-group/
使用私服
nrm use private
切回npm官方源
nrm use npm